2011 Supreme(J&K) 581

HASNAIN MASSODI
B. L. Gupta & Anr. – Appellant
Versus
Naseem –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
Mr. P.N. Raina, Sr. Adv. with Mr. Anupam Raina, Adv. for Petitioner.
Mr. Rajinder Singh Jamwal, Adv. for Respondent.

1. The petitioner No.1 is Printer, Publisher and Editor of Daily Early Times, published from Jammu and petitioner no.2 — its Managing Director. The petitioners' newspaper, in its issue dated 10th May, 2008, published a news item referring to a Srinagar based Women Organization — "Dukhtaran-e-Millat" as "anti-India and Secessionist Organization" and its leader — Aasiya Andrabi as "obscurantist and Islamic fundamentalist".

2. Ms. Naseem W/o Mohd. Rashid, R/o Kanyari, Tehsil and District Kathua, claiming to have deep faith in the Organization and to respect its efforts for highlighting the duties of the Muslim women, filed a criminal complaint in the Court of Chief Judicial Magistrate, Kathua, alleging commission of offence punish#31;able under Sections 500,501 and 502 RPC against the Printer, Publisher, Editor and Managing Director of Daily Early Times-petitioners herein. The respondent's case before the Trial Magistrate was that the news item in question was defamatory in character and lowered the reputation of the Organization and that of all those associated with the Organization.
